Output 26e45f6e79ac6992b38fc5462fbd17136e9025de2143acc192c4c37126eaf14a:42

value
840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cbe97baecdfa9374437947412c3de1a4eae1c82 OP_EQUAL
address
3A9QQodhX4iQfYeBPZqyinUhunT5Decon5
transaction
26e45f6e79ac6992b38fc5462fbd17136e9025de2143acc192c4c37126eaf14a